WebA subset of heavy tailed distributions CCDF approaches a power function for large x For such distributions: all moments E[x l] for all values of l > αare infinite. If α < 2, x has infinite variance If α < 1, the variable has infinite mean α is called the tail index. All power law distributions are heavy tailed but all heavy tailed

WebMar 7, 2024 · 1. The classical concept of "heavy tails" that we are usually interested in is when the tails are sufficiently heavy to give infinite variance. This occurs under power-law tail behaviour when one or both tails decay at a rate that is no faster than cubic decay.
